Output 6c989438ea8c854ddeddd40d90604a9a5e0d157ea6be11023614986c4b0dff31:2

value
6525224332
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3c06630e842cc2f0e174aa5bffca51c2468f1ba1a31caf21330f0a5ad5967ae1
address
tb1p8srxxr5y9np0pct54fdlljj3cfrg7xap5vw27gfnpu9944vk0tssgq687g
transaction
6c989438ea8c854ddeddd40d90604a9a5e0d157ea6be11023614986c4b0dff31
confirmations
75778
spent
true